Jedi TEv- I was thinking the same thing. And Panhandle, you're right, to fit the last few pieces in, they may have had to remove the dock plate. But usually, you can leave the dock lock on in those situations- and if the dock guys could have, I bet they wished they had. Or given clear instructions to the driver. Or chocked his trailer tires. Or made him drop the trailer.Or taken his keys (like Sam's Club does, for live unloads/loads).
One load lock and this video would not be here to amuse us...
